"I am the Great Han King of the East Sea. I am the Civilization Emissary of the Three Kingdoms Civilization Region. I wonder if you are willing to submit to me?"

Yang Rui did not avoid speaking to the other party as they entered the meeting room under the guidance of the village's old Confucian scholar.

However, after the old man dressed like a Confucian scholar heard Yang Rui's words, he frowned as if he did not know.

Most of the NPCs in ordinary villages in the Three Kingdoms Civilization Region did not know about the Civilization Emissary, let alone an old man in a village in Yizhou. Moreover, it was not difficult for Yang Rui to see that the old man had not heard of the identity of the so-called Civilization Emissary.

"This is the token of the Yucong Tribe. I wonder if you and your tribe know of the Yucong Tribe?"

Yang Rui continued to ask tentatively. He did not have much hope. After all, even Yang Rui had not heard of such a tribe before coming into contact with it.

However, in the face of Yang Rui's question, the old man immediately revealed an expression of surprise. His lips and cheeks trembled slightly, and his eyes flickered. In the end, he looked up and down Yang Rui again.

From the old man's identity, Yang Rui quickly learned that perhaps the other party had some relationship with the Yucong Tribe.

"I wonder if you are involved with the Yucong Tribe?"

Before Yang Rui could ask, the old man in the village had already asked. His expression flickered as if he was quite sensitive to the Yucong Tribe.

Yang Rui was not sure whether the old man and the Yucong Tribe were friends or foes.

"To be honest, I am the Civilization Emissary. I intend to find the whereabouts of the Yucong Tribe and other tribes. It can be said that we are of the same tribe. Does the old man have any news of the Yucong Tribe?"

In the end, Yang Rui decided to tell the truth. It would be best if the old man and the village in front of him could fight for them. If they could not fight for them, then he would just wipe them out.

"Sigh … Fine. Since my lord is able to take out the Jade Cong Tribe's token, you should be a noble of my tribe. This one has doubts in my heart because of some other matters. I shouldn't have doubted my lord.

Since you're being honest with me, this old man has nothing to hide. This old man and all the people in the village are surnamed Shi, and we're a branch of the Yucong tribe. It's our fortune to meet you today. If you don't mind, I'm willing to lead all the Liegeman in the tribe to serve you … "

The village elder bowed and said something. It turned out that he was a member of the Yucong Tribe, and the village in front of them was also a branch of the Yucong Tribe. The elder was willing to join the village, which was exactly what Yang Rui wanted.

"Senior, there's no need to be like this. I've just arrived here, and I have a favor to ask of you …"

After the two sides had spoken, it saved a lot of effort. Following that, Yang Rui and the village elder conversed again, and the relationship between the two sides was greatly improved. In the end, the elder also decided to use the entire clan to subdue Yang Rui.

It turned out that the elder's surname was Shi Ma, and he was a descendant of a branch of the Yucong Tribe surnamed Shi in the pre-Qin period. The tribe originally lived in Minyue and made a living by fishing. Shi Ma's ancestors were scattered in the storm to Yizhou.

The reason why the elder was not sure of Yang Rui's identity was because the Yucong Tribe and the Barbarian Tribe had a life-and-death feud, so he had some doubts.

Moreover, the Yucong Tribe had a sizable fleet back then. Although the elder and his fleet were forced to Yizhou by the storm, they believed that the tribe would send other ships to rescue them.

In the end, they did not see anyone from the tribe for generations, so the people on Yizhou Island guessed that the Yucong Tribe might have been wiped out by the Barbarian Tribe, and that the Barbarian Tribe might come to seek revenge. In addition to the previous conflict, the elder's vigilance was inevitably higher.

Through the elder's introduction, Yang Rui also learned a lot about the situation on Yizhou Island. There were indeed many villages like the elder's on the island, and most of them were friends and not enemies. Only some of the local savage tribes were uncivilized.

The savage tribes were mostly on the eastern side of the island, while the Yucong Tribe and some branches of other tribes were mostly in the central and western areas. Most of them lived on high mountains and hunted for a living.

This made Yang Rui think of the Gaoshan tribe in the real world. He did not know if their origin had anything to do with this. But based on the situation of the Yucong Tribe and other tribes entering Yizhou Island since the pre-Qin period, it was possible.

According to the elder's introduction, there were only three or four villages that occasionally interacted with his village through marriage, and they were all far away. One of the villages was also the descendant of the Yucong Tribe, and there were more marriages. The other villages only allowed marriages under special circumstances.

With the elder and his village subdued, the progress of obtaining the origin of Yizhou's civilization reached more than 10%, and the next step was much easier. After discussing with the elder, Yang Rui directly took the elder's soul on the Void Crossing Airship to several villages with which they had interacted.

Among them, the Yucong Tribe quickly chose to submit to Yang Rui. Although the other villages did not submit, they did not treat Yang Rui with hostility. Most importantly, the progress of obtaining the origin of Yizhou's civilization was constantly increasing.

With the soul speed of the Void Crossing Airship, Yang Rui used the villages as a link to quickly move around the island. In less than five game days, he had visited all the villages in the western and central regions of Yizhou Island that the old man had mentioned. The total number of villages he had visited was actually only 101, just breaking through a hundred.

There were over a hundred villages on Yizhou Island, and the NPCs that belonged to them all came from the other side of the ocean. The villages varied in size, and the largest had yet to be upgraded to the Town level. They had no more than 1,000 people, and the smallest only had a little over 100 people.

By the time Yang Rui visited the last village, the progress of obtaining the origin of Yizhou's civilization had reached 100%. He had successfully met the requirements to be recognized by the small tribes of Yizhou Island.

System Notice: Congratulations to player Blazing Sun for obtaining 100% information on the origin of Yizhou's civilization within the specified time. Under the prerequisite of being a Civilization Envoy, you have received the recognition of 101 villages from the various small tribes of Yizhou. All the NPCs in these villages have submitted to you, and all the ownership of the territory belongs to you …

A system notice was sent over in a timely manner. The 101 villages and their NPC Liegeman on Yizhou Island had submitted to him. Yang Rui had not expected the process to be so simple.

Of course, this was also due to Yang Rui's identity as a Civilization Envoy and the speed of the Void Crossing Airship. Without either of these factors, the current situation would not have been possible.

Although the 101 villages and NPCs had submitted to him, it did not mean that Yizhou Island had become Yang Rui's property. There were still savage tribes in the eastern part of the island.

Moreover, after Yang Rui's initial contact, the savage tribes in the eastern part of the island were not small in number. In terms of numbers, they were much larger than the NPC villages in the western part of the island.
